Bug: if you are matching on (noun), the match won't work for words that come up as Form: v,n in debug. In other words (noun) will match "car," but it won't match "ship," or "train." It will match "movie," but it won't match "book."
The parser is apparently giving up the idea that a word might be a noun once it sees it can be a verb.
